Both will be great for the area and we look forward to covering the achievements as the week rolls on.
Last year we had significant public pushback - and divided opinion on the fishing tournament.
By embracing the tag and release concept, organisers have ensured the longevity of what has become an iconic event on our local sporting landscape. Facts are that the majority of fish caught throughout the competition are tagged and released.
All data collected from caught species is used by scientists and marine biologists to track migration patterns. It also highlights the area's pristine beauty.
The tournament highlights our pristine beaches and waterways, and the several hundred visitors coming to town ensures a huge boost to the local economy.
